Service overview

Consistency between therapy sessions.

Physiotherapy and rehabilitation programs work best with regular practice — but many seniors need a steady, safe hand to help with exercises and mobility routines between professional sessions.

Our caregivers work alongside your loved one's physiotherapist or rehabilitation team, providing encouragement, safety supervision and consistent support with prescribed exercises and mobility aids, so progress continues between appointments.

Is it time?

Signs rehabilitation support could help.

  • A recent injury, surgery or illness affecting mobility or strength
  • Difficulty remembering or completing prescribed exercises independently
  • Increased fall risk during mobility practice at home
  • A physiotherapist has recommended additional at-home support
  • Family caregivers feel unsure how to safely assist with exercises
  • Progress has stalled without consistent practice between sessions
